*First of all, both babies had another great weigh in last night - Evie was 3 lbs 6 3/4 oz and Jackson was 3 lbs 7 1/2 oz! I will call the NICU in a little while to see, but both babes are expected to be back up to their birth weights tonight!!

*And the super exciting news.... today, at what would be 32 weeks, 2 days gestation, both babies were offered a bottle for the first time!!!!! Evie drank 13 cc's from the bottle and Jackson drank 11 cc's! the rest was given through their feeding tubes. It was wonderful,wonderful,wonderful!!!!!! The criteria for going home from the NICU is to be about 4 1/2 lbs, take all feedings by bottle or breast, maintain body temperature on their own and be gaining weight consistently.
